Florence-Darlington Technical College is seeking an Accounts Receivable Specialist to manage student receivables and ensure timely billing in accordance with college policies. The role includes posting payments, reconciling transactions, and providing backup support for accounts payable and cashiering activities.
The ideal candidate has an accounting background (associate degree or equivalent experience) and strong communication and organizational skills.
Under supervision of the Controller, this position is responsible for analyzing and managing collection of all student receivables. This position is responsible for ensuring students proceed through the billing process in a timely manner according to FDTC policies and procedures. Must be able to communicate effectively with other internal offices as well as with external parties, such as students and any third-party agencies. Assist with cashiering, telephones and serve as AP backup as needed.
Associate degree with accounting related courses and two (2) years of accounting work experience; or a high school diploma with four (4) years of accounting work experience.
The minimum as listed, plus good general accounting, telephone, and organizational skills; knowledgeable with integrated software packages, imaging systems, Excel and securely importing/scanning/uploading data to internal and external systems. Proficient in working with data record layouts and troubleshooting technology issues. Experience in analyzing accounts receivable, and possess excellent communication and customer service skills. Experience working with the public. Dependability and good customer service skills are also important abiliies for this job.
